Easy Samoas Cookies recipe

All Recipes Dessert Recipes Cookies

Ingredients

1 (14 ounce) package sweetened flaked coconut
1 (18 ounce) package refrigerated sugar cookie dough, halved lengthwise and cut into slices
1 (12 ounce) jar caramel sundae syrup
1 (12 ounce) jar hot fudge topping

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).

  2. Pour coconut into a shallow bowl. Press each cookie dough slice into coconut to coat both sides. Arrange coated slices on a baking sheet.

  3. Bake in the preheated oven until lightly golden, 10 to 12 minutes. Cool completely.

  4. Drizzle caramel syrup over cooled cookies and top with hot fudge topping. Chill in the refrigerator until set, about 30 minutes.

Recipe Yield

15 servings
